  • The essential duties, but not limited to, for Aviation Technical Specialist 1* in the Planning and Environmental Track include
  • Assigned approximately 10 to 15 public-use airports for which they perform the following, but not limited to:
  • Assist the development and update of Capital Improvements Plans (CIPs) for each airport annually including programming phase;
  • Assisting communities on technical aspects of terminal and visual navigational aids and Global Positioning System (GPS) approaches;
  • Assisting communities on compatible land use planning on and off airport property;
  • Coordination and review the Federal 7460-1 forms (Notice of Proposed Construction) for on-airport development;
  • Review preliminary studies or surveys and cost estimates for project feasibility and funding;
  • Assist airport sponsors with development, coordination, and review of airport master plans, airport layout plan sets, and the airport Capital Improvement Plan;
  • Assist with property acquisition preparation and relocation assistance;
  • Review and approve environmental documentation, as required under applicable State and Federal laws or regulations, in accordance with FAA Advisory Circular 150/5100-21, FAA Orders 1050.1and 5050.4;
  • Coordinate with FAA reporting all comments to the State Historic Preservation Officer or the Advisory Council on Historic Preservation. Organize an investigation, if required, to meet the provisions of the National Historic Preservation Act of 1966
  • Work to identify aviation infrastructure issues for maintenance, repair, safety, environmental, and operational needs;
  • Work to ensure project selection and continuity through collaboration and effective communication with the internal/external stakeholders and project team;
  • Understand and apply techniques, procedures, and design criteria in accordance with technical manuals (i.e. FAA Advisory Circular) to develop and/or implement detailed specifications for aviation projects;
  • Review Independent Fee Estimate results associated to planning projects to confirm consultant fees are acceptable;
  • Learn to become proficient in different funding components and project selection scoring processes for Federal and State funded projects;
  • Learn key components of technical disciplines within a matrix organization to ensure project successfulness by engaging the proper individuals for project needs;
  • Utilize various software platforms to review and sketching/comment on documents.
